    DEMAT In India‚ shares and securities are held electronically in a Dematerialized (or "Demat") account‚ instead of the investor taking physical possession of certificates. A Dematerialized account is opened by the investor while registering with an investment broker (or sub-broker). The Dematerialized account number is quoted for all transactions to enable electronic settlements of trades to take place. Costco provides its consumer with lower prices than a conventional supermerchant by charging its customers an annual membership fee. This fee gives the consumer the right to shop at the warehouse club for items found often in bulk and usually at a lower price.
